Zusammenfassung
The Trek Domane is celebrated for its endurance geometry, offering a comfortable and stable ride suitable for long distances and newer riders. Its versatility is highlighted by the ability to accommodate larger tires up to 38mm, making it a contender for light gravel use. Reviews praise its smooth ride quality, thanks to the IsoSpeed technology, and its sleek design with internal cable routing. However, some note the bike's performance can be hindered by stock components, and the price point for higher-end models is a point of contention.
Endurance geometry suitable for long rides and newer riders
Versatile with room for larger tires up to 38mm
Smooth ride quality due to IsoSpeed technology
Sleek design with internal cable routing
Lightweight frame compared to previous models
Performance can be limited by stock components
Higher-end models are considered pricey
Some models have reported issues with seatpost slipping and internal cable routing

Feb. 2023 · James Huang
Trek’s latest iteration of its Domane all-roader packs more performance than ever, but there are also some big missteps that give me pause.
Superb rear-end ride quality, stiff and efficient-feeling under power, excellent handling, sleek aesthetics, competitively weight.
Ride quality still a little imbalanced, creaky IsoSpeed/seatpost area, exposed headset bearing, internal housing rub, disappointing tires.
